Sa Kaeo: After cutting off telephone and internet signals in Sa Kaeo Province and near the Khlong Luek border checkpoint, which is on the Thai-Cambodian border, today the operation is still ongoing. According to Thai News Agency, authorities have intensified efforts to dismantle the operations of the infamous Aranyaprathet call center gang. The gang has been known for exploiting communication networks to deceive individuals across Thailand. By targeting the communication infrastructure, officials aim to disrupt the gang’s ability to operate effectively and further prevent fraudulent activities.
The operation involves a coordinated shutdown of telecommunication services in critical areas used by the gang. This strategic move is expected to cripple the gang’s operations and limit their reach. The focus is on the vicinity of the Khlong Luek border checkpoint, a known hotspot for cross-border criminal activities. Authorities are monitoring the situation closely to assess the impact of these measures on the gang’s activities.
